The son of Afrobeat pioneer, Femi Kuti drops a brand new track and video titled “Pa Pa Pa”.

Pa Pa Pa‘ Earlier than Femi Kuti was his personal bandleader, he began taking part in saxophone in his father – Fela Kuti’s – band, Egypt 80, in 1979, the place he discovered the ins and outs of performing with a legend. “My father was so enormous,” Femi says with amusing. “I taught myself every part I knew, so I used to be studying on the job, and you aren’t allowed to make errors. Being in entrance of such an icon, it may be intimidating.” In 1984, Femi had no alternative however to satisfy his future after Fela was arrested on the Lagos airport simply earlier than the beginning of a U.S. tour and Femi was requested to be the frontman of his father’s band as an alternative of cancelling the reveals.

In 1986, Femi created his personal band, referred to as Constructive Pressure, which rapidly gained notoriety as a formidable group in Afrobeat music. Over the subsequent 30 years, Femi would amass worldwide acclaim as an envoy of this righteous music and lots of humanitarian organizations. Constructive Pressure remains to be on the forefront of the Afrobeat motion, increasing the music’s vocabulary by including hints of punk and hip-hop to the sound, whereas sustaining its conventional roots and political message. Femi has carried out on a few of the world’s most prestigious phases and festivals, and collaborated with iconic musicians throughout a big selection of genres, most recently Coldplay on their track “Arabesque,” which is featured on their newest album On a regular basis Life.

Cease The Hate — Femi’s eleventh studio album — arrives simply when listeners want it most, as Black individuals all through the world proceed the combat for equal rights and the top of police brutality. All through his album, Femi criticizes the native authorities for inflicting chaos when it must be selling peace. “From corruption him shut eye take cash,” Femi sings on the distinctive “You Can’t Struggle Corruption With Corruption.” In an interview, he delves higher into the which means: “I’m speaking in regards to the authorities in Nigeria. The president tried to win the election, and he surrounds himself with all people who’s corrupt. You may’t take cash from criminals after which combat criminals. In case you are a great man, you don’t take cash from unhealthy guys to combat unhealthy guys. You simply must discover a higher solution to combat unhealthy guys.”

“Pà Pá Pà” is taken from the forthcoming album Legacy +, out February 12 on Partisan Information. The track video was shot on the Afrika Shrine in Alausa, Ikeja, Lagos by video director Adasa Cookey.
